India’s COVID Count Crosses 5.6 Lakh Cases

New Delhi: The total tally of COVID-19 cases in the country went up to 566,840 with the addition of 18,522 new cases in the past 24 hours, the Union Health Ministry said on Saturday.

Meanwhile, 418 new fatalities across the country since Friday took the toll to 16,893, the ministry added.

According to ICMR, 86 lakh samples have been tested for COVID-19 so far, including 2,1 lakh on Monday.

With 1,69,883 confirmed cases of COVID-19, Maharashtra remains the worst-affected state in the country, followed by Tamil Nadu (86,224) and Delhi (85,161).

At present, there are 215,125 active cases in the country and 334,821 patients have recovered from the infection.
